Job description

Join our Talent Analytics team within the Talent Technology Center of Excellence. Here, you will be instrumental in leveraging predictive analytics to transform how we understand and manage talent across the organization.

As a Senior Analyst, you will not only handle technical analysis and data modeling but also shape the future of our analytics capabilities by spearheading projects that forecast trends and outcomes

What You Will
  • Leveraging HR systems and database tools, develop and deliver ad-hoc, recurring, and on-demand / self-service analysis solutions.
  • Working with Power BI to build and maintain self-service dashboards or to craft visualizations for stakeholder presentations.
  • Advanced Predictive Analytics & Modeling: Contribute to predictive models using machine learning and natural language processing techniques. Your work will directly contribute to strategic decision-making and enhancing our predictive analytics capabilities.
  • Proactive Insight Generation: As a Talent Analytics Sr. Analyst it will be up to you to leverage your analysis skills to provide proactive insights to provide the business. The key to success in this role is your ability to break down complex concepts and tell a story from an analysis.
  • Strategic Project Management: Designing, estimating, and personally executing an analysis plan based on requirements you gather from key stakeholders. In this role you will have the opportunity to lead and manage multiple strategic projects that have a real impact on business outcomes.
  • Innovative Tool Implementation: Work closely with the Talent Systems and Technology teams to drive the adoption of cutting-edge analytics tools, optimizing them to meet evolving business needs.
  • Problem Solving: Use analytics to solve key talent business questions and provide support for core functions by incorporating proactive outreach on trends and external benchmarking.
Responsibilities
  • Using HR systems and database tools to develop and deliver ad hoc, recurring, and on-demand / self-service analysis and data solutions.
  • Independently or with a team, exploring and implementing new ways to take on data or technical challenges.
  • Designing, estimating, and personally executing an analysis plan based on a high-level functional issue description or business question.
  • Describing your own analysis and the insights you draw from it to others in HR or the business.
  • Recommending business process or system improvements to reporting capabilities and influence system owners to incorporate changes.
  • Peer reviewing SQL code/reporting and performing data validation as related to data acquisition for analytic purposes.
  • Ensuring products are delivered that are audience appropriate, adhering to HR standards for data sharing and meeting the client’s need accurately.
Technical/Soft Skills
  • Required: Minimum of 3 years using data transformation tools such as Alteryx and SQL to query large
  • Minimum of 2 years of solutioning, preparing, and visualizing data for non-technical stakeholders using Power BI (report creation, DAX, power query, and data modeling)
  • Experience using RStudio or Python for automation or data processing such as statistical modeling, machine learning, or data mining
  • Strong analytical and quantitative problem-solving ability
  • Excellent communication, relationship skills and a strong team player
  • An understanding of core Human Resources functions, typical workforce management processes and related data
  • Experience in HR related systems: Workday, Cornerstone, Qualtrics, VNDLY, ServiceNow
  • Experience with other presentations tools such as PowerPoint
  • and Visio
  • Experience defining, structuring, and documenting data
